Transaction 2fa84251d635a78121cfb9fad8025d7dad39ef448b2f55bd1b4495150cd58e4c
1 Input
1 Output
-
2fa84251d635a78121cfb9fad8025d7dad39ef448b2f55bd1b4495150cd58e4c:0
- value
- 308785
- script pubkey
- OP_0 OP_PUSHBYTES_20 bc2bdd089a886aae638904f180282132a1bdca4d
- address
- bc1qhs4a6zy63p42ucufqnccq2ppx2smmjjdqp59up